Jealous of what...lol The fact that hondas have less torque than me pulling on a breaker bar...Originally Posted by §treet_§peed
Jealous of what...lol The fact that hondas have less torque than me pulling on a breaker bar...Originally Posted by §treet_§peed
My YouTube Channel
Make sure you "like" the videos purdy please.